Set into the side of the harbour bowl, this charming loft apartment enjoys fabulous views of Brixham’s fishing boats in the water. The building is grade II listed and sits on one of the oldest streets in this coastal village. A three-minute stroll into town sees you at the harbour front where cosy pubs, seafood restaurants and the odd swanky cocktail bar await. The South-west Coastal Path runs along the harbour front, and you can follow this out to clifftop walks and stunning sea views. Our favourite thing about this loft apartment has to be the private terrace, overlooking the harbour fringed by colourful fishing houses. Out here, you’ve got comfy rattan sofas and chairs for an evening tipple and a gas grill for barbecue lunches. The view continues inside where a big bay window floods the living room with sunlight. If you’re not barbecuing, the full kitchen has everything you need to cook up the catch of the day and there’s more than enough room for the group to dine together inside.

Home truths

    There are twenty steep stone steps up to this home so it may not be suitable for those with limited mobility

    A cot, stair gates and high chair can be provided but please bring your own linen

    On a narrow, old street, driving up to this home is not possible but there is a permit for parking a short walk away included
